    Before we get into the nitty-gritty of David Harbour height, let’s take a moment to appreciate the man himself. Born on April 10, 1975, in New York City, David Harbour didn’t start his career as a Hollywood star overnight. Instead, he worked his way up through theater, indie films, and television shows, honing his craft and building a reputation for delivering powerful performances.

    His journey began at the prestigious Juilliard School, where he studied acting alongside future stars like Viola Davis and Jesse Eisenberg. This rigorous training laid the foundation for his versatile acting style, which blends intensity with vulnerability. But it wasn’t until his breakout role as Jim Hopper in Stranger Things that he truly became a household name.

    David Harbour Height: The Official Stats

    According to verified sources, David Harbour stands at 6 feet 1 inch (185 cm). That’s pretty tall by most standards, especially when you consider the average height for adult men in the United States is around 5 feet 9 inches. But here’s the thing: height isn’t everything. While David’s stature certainly contributes to his commanding presence, it’s his talent and charisma that truly set him apart.

    The Truth About Camera Angles and Height Perception

    One reason height myths persist is because of the way cameras can distort perception. For example, a wide-angle lens can make an actor appear taller or shorter depending on how it’s used. Directors and cinematographers often use these techniques to enhance a character’s physical presence or create a specific mood.

    In David Harbour’s case, his height is often exaggerated by the way scenes are framed. For instance, in Stranger Things, Jim Hopper is often shot from a low angle to emphasize his authority and protectiveness. This makes David appear even taller than he actually is, adding to his larger-than-life persona.
